How to Create a Members-Only Product or Page on Shopify (Step-by-Step)
Building a successful online store isn't just about broadcasting to everyone. Sometimes, your most powerful strategy is to create something not everyone can see. Whether it's an exclusive product line, a VIP collection, or a gated resource page for top clients, learning how to create a members only product on Shopify can transform your customer relationships and your bottom line.
I’m a developer who’s spent years in the Shopify ecosystem, and I built Latch specifically to solve this access control puzzle. The desire to gate content on Shopify or create a members only Shopify store is a common and powerful request from merchants looking to foster community and exclusivity.
Let’s break down exactly why you’d want to do this and, most importantly, the step-by-step methods to make it happen.
Why Create Members-Only Products or Pages on Shopify?
Before we dive into the "how," let's solidify the "why." An exclusive access model isn't about being secretive; it's a strategic business lever. According to insights from eCommerce Thesis, these stores "offer curated products, special discounts, and early access to new arrivals—all reserved for registered members." This creates a powerful psychological effect: perceived value skyrockets when access is limited.
The core benefits are clear:
- Increased Customer Loyalty & LTV: Members feel part of an inner circle, which increases repeat purchases and customer lifetime value.
- Higher Perceived Value: Exclusive products or content can command premium pricing. Scarcity and exclusivity are classic drivers of demand.
- Better Customer Data: Requiring an account or login to access certain areas helps you build a richer understanding of your most engaged customers.
- Controlled Launches & Feedback: As noted in guides on creating hidden pages, they provide "a controlled environment to gather feedback from a select group before a full public launch."
- Tiered Monetization: You can create different membership levels (e.g., Free, Silver, Gold) with access to different products or collections, opening up recurring revenue streams.
Ultimately, learning how to create a members only product on Shopify is about building a deeper, more valuable relationship with your best customers.
Step-by-Step: How to Lock a Product or Page for Specific Customers
Shopify’s native functionality allows for some basic access control, primarily through password-protecting your entire store. But for granular control—like restricting a product to certain customers or making a single page exclusive—you typically need a more nuanced approach. Here are the two primary methods, from simple to advanced.
Method 1: Using Native Shopify Customer Tags & Manual Hiding (The Manual Way)
This method works if you have a small, defined group of members (like a beta test group or a corporate client list) and you don't mind some manual management.
- Tag Your Exclusive Customers: In your Shopify admin, go to Customers. Select the customers who should have access and add a specific tag to them, like
VIP-MEMBERorCLUB-ACCESS. - Create Your "Hidden" Product or Collection: Create your exclusive product or collection as you normally would. In the product’s description or in a metafield, you could note it’s for members only, but it will still be publicly accessible at this point.
- Manually Hide the Product from Your Theme: This is the clunky part. You would need to edit your theme code (like
product.liquidorcollection.liquid) to add logic that checks if the logged-in customer has the specific tagVIP-MEMBER. If they do, show the product. If they don’t or are not logged in, hide it. - Redirect or Show a Message: For a better experience, you’d want to redirect non-members or show a "Join the club to access" message instead of just a blank space.
The Drawback: This requires comfort with Shopify’s Liquid code, is not scalable, and is easy to break with theme updates. It also doesn’t easily lock a collection on Shopify or protect pages/blogs.
Method 2: Using a Dedicated Access Control App (The Scalable Way)
For most store owners, using a dedicated app is the most reliable and feature-rich path. This is the problem space I work in, and it’s why tools like the one I built exist. Apps are designed to gate content on Shopify without you touching a line of code.
Here’s the generalized step-by-step flow using an access control app (like Latch):
- Install Your Chosen App: From the Shopify App Store, install an app designed for membership and access control.
- Define Your Membership Rules: Create a rule or "lock." You’ll typically specify:
- What to Lock: Choose a specific product, an entire collection, a page, a blog, or even a discount code.
- Who Gets Access: Set the access condition. This is often based on:
- Customer Tags: (e.g., anyone with the tag
PREMIUM). - Account Status: (e.g., any logged-in customer).
- Specific Customer Lists: (e.g., only emails X, Y, Z).
- Purchase History: (e.g., anyone who bought product A).
- Customer Tags: (e.g., anyone with the tag
- Customize the Denial Experience: Decide what non-members see. A good app will let you show a custom message, a password prompt, or redirect them to a sign-up page. This is how you effectively Shopify hide product until logged in with a professional UX.
- Publish the Rule: Activate it. The app will now automatically enforce your Shopify customer tag access control logic across your store.
This method is robust, survives theme updates, and lets you manage everything from a simple dashboard. It’s the recommended approach for anyone serious about setting up a membership site on Shopify.
Advanced Tactics: Member-Only Pricing, Upsells, and Redirecting Non-Members
Once you have the basic lock in place, you can layer in advanced strategies to maximize your membership program.
- Shopify Member Only Pricing: This is a huge driver of value. The process is similar: use your access control app to hide the standard price and purchase button, and replace it with a special members-only price for tagged customers. This creates a powerful incentive to join the membership tier.
- Strategic Upsells Within the Gated Area: Once a member is inside your exclusive collection, use Shopify's native cross-sell features or an app to recommend complementary exclusive products. They’re already in the "VIP mindset," making them more likely to add to cart.
- Smart Redirects for Non-Members: Don’t just show a "no access" message. Redirect them to a page that sells the benefits of membership. Turn a moment of restriction into a conversion opportunity for your membership program.
- Tiered Access with Multiple Tags: Use different customer tags (e.g.,
TIER-SILVER,TIER-GOLD) to create layered access. Gold members might see exclusive products and get member-only pricing, while Silver members only get the pricing benefit. This is the essence of a sophisticated members only Shopify store.
Best Practices for Managing Your Shopify Membership Program
- Communicate Value Clearly: Before asking for an email or a purchase, be crystal clear about what members get. Is it products, content, discounts, or all three?
- Make Sign-Up Frictionless: The barrier to entry should be appropriate. A free membership requiring just an email is easy. A paid membership should have a very clear value proposition upfront.
- Use Your Exclusivity: Announce "members-only first access" to new products or sales. This makes members feel valued and drives urgency.
- Leverage Automation: Use Shopify Flow or your email marketing tool (Klaviyo, Mailchimp) to automatically tag customers when they join a paid membership plan via a subscription app or make a qualifying purchase. This automates your Shopify customer tag access control.
- Audit and Refresh: Periodically review your exclusive offerings. Are they still desirable? Update products, content, and perks to keep your membership fresh.
Common Questions About Shopify Access Control Apps (FAQs)
Q: Can I natively password-protect just one product in Shopify? A: No, Shopify’s built-in password protection is all-or-nothing for your entire storefront. To Shopify password protect a product or page individually, you need a dedicated app.
Q: Is there a limit to how many products or pages I can lock? A: With most robust apps, no. As one guide confirms about hidden pages, "Shopify does not impose a strict limit on the number of pages you can create," and a good access control app won't limit you either. You can lock your entire catalog if you want.
Q: Will locking products hurt my SEO?
A: If done correctly, no. A proper access control app will use meta tags (noindex, nofollow) on locked pages to tell search engines not to index them, preventing SEO issues. Public-facing pages about your membership program should be indexed to attract members.
Q: Can I offer a free membership tier vs. a paid one? A: Absolutely. This is a common and effective strategy. You might use a free membership (requiring just an account) to access a basic resource library, while a paid membership unlocks Shopify exclusive access products and deeper discounts. Access control apps let you set rules based on different tags for each tier.
Q: Do I need to be a coder to set this up? A: Not if you use an app. The whole point of apps like Latch is to provide a visual, no-code interface to set up a membership site on Shopify. You define the rules using dropdowns and checkboxes, not code.
Final Takeaway
Learning how to create a members only product on Shopify is one of the most effective ways to elevate your store from a transactional marketplace to a branded community. Whether you start small with a single locked collection on Shopify or launch a full multi-tier membership, the principles are the same: define what’s exclusive, define who gets access, and use the right tools to enforce it seamlessly.
The manual coding route offers a free proof-of-concept, but for a stable, scalable, and feature-complete membership system, a dedicated app is the professional choice. It saves you time, prevents technical headaches, and allows you to focus on what matters most—creating incredible value for your most important customers.
Michael Thomson
Software Developer specializing in Shopify apps and e-commerce solutions.
Get in touchRelated Articles
How to Create a Shopify Membership Site in 2026 Without Code
Learn how to build a Shopify membership site in 2026 using customer tags to lock pages, products, and collections. No coding required—perfect for exclusive content and wholesale.
How to Edit Shopify Website Without Coding in 2026
Learn exactly how to edit your Shopify website without coding in 2026. Step-by-step guide to visual editing, theme customization, and making professional changes yourself.
How to Lock Shopify Pages by Customer Tags in 2026
Learn the step-by-step method to restrict Shopify pages to specific customer groups using tags. Perfect for membership sites, wholesale stores, and exclusive content in 2026.